In September 1952, James Hill, his wife, and their five children were held hostage by escaped convicts in their suburban Pennsylvania home. After a nineteen-hour ordeal, the Hills were released unharmed and two of the convicts were later killed in a gun battle with police. The story generated significant media attention. But the Hills discouraged publicity, stressed that they had not been mistreated during their capture, and moved to a new city. Later, an author penned an account of a family taken hostage by escaped convicts in their suburban home. The book was made into a play, and Time published an account of the play in the pages of Life magazine. Photos showed the play’s cast acting out violent episodes staged at the Hills’ former home. The article used the Hills’ name. Alleging that the story misrepresented his family’s experience, Hill sued for damages under New York’s statutory right of privacy which proscribes using another’s name or picture for commercial purposes without consent. The jury returned a verdict for Hill. The appellate division affirmed but ordered a new trial on damages. After the second trial, the New York Court of Appeals affirmed.
